A PbTiO3 (PT) particle / organic hybrid was synthesized through polymerization and condensation of metal-organics at 125°C in 2-methoxyethanol. PT precursors were synthesized using lead benzoate derivatives and titanium isopropoxide. The formation of PbTiO3 precursor was confirmed by FT-IR, 1H and 13C NMR. The organic ligands were found to coordinate the PT precursors. The electrorheological (ER) properties of suspensions were studied using a rotational viscometer under DC field. The suspension was prepared from the hybrid and silicone oil. The dielectric constant of the suspension was also measured. The generated yield stress increased as the hydrolysis water increased in amount. The ER properties were also dependent upon the kind of organic ligand.
